Jamie O’Hara unleashed a typical rant about Tottenham Hotspur, and the pundit is already losing hope, just a month into the new season.Spurs suffered a 3-1 loss at Anfield in the third round of the Carabao Cup on Tuesday, which means that they have now lost three in six this campaign, and scored just one goal in five matches against Premier League opposition.Tottenham looked much more threatening going forward at Anfield than they have in other matches this season, but they were once again unable to take their opportunities.While De Zerbi is confident that things will click for Spurs soon, one pundit can only see things going from bad to worse for the Lilywhites.Credit: talkSPORTJamie O’Hara says Tottenham have a losing ‘disease’Just six games into the campaign, O’Hara has already had enough of Tottenham, admitting that he now goes into every game expecting his club to get beaten.The pundit is appalled that even spending £400m on new signings and getting a talented manager through the door has not fixed Tottenham’s malaise.O’Hara told talkSPORT: “Seriously, what is going on?. I feel like every day I wake up and it’s the same thing. Every single time Spurs play, I look at the fixtures and I’m like, ‘Spurs are playing tonight, alright, here we go, get beat’. I don’t know what to say. It’s Groundhog Day.“This is the perfect night again for Cundy. When is my night? I’ve been here for five years, and I’ve had one good night. One. The Europa League final, that was it. It’s absolute guff, it really is, and I’m sick and tired of it. I know it’s all great and everyone enjoys it, but this is actually getting ridiculous.“Where do Spurs go from here? We have got a disease. We don’t know how to win. Even when we score, we get beat. Every single game no matter what, Spurs get beat. Spend £400million – get beat. Score – get beat. New manager – get beat. We’ve got a disease.”O’Hara insists Spurs should have gone down last seasonThe former Tottenham midfielder suggested that the Lilywhites were lucky to avoid relegation and that they would have gone down if not for other sides doing them a favour.He also added that he never wants to see Mathys Tel play for Spurs again, admitting that he would rather see Richarlison play over the Frenchman.O’Hara continued: “You know what should have happened, we should have gone down. We are so bad. We’re shocking. The only reason we stayed up is because Aston Villa guffed it and Everton jacked it in at the end of the season.“I thought we might start the new season and see something different, something positive. No, absolute guff again. We don’t deserve to be playing Premier League teams. We are absolutely useless.” The problem is we don’t take our chances and are soft. Ice creams. We’re like a flake in 30-degree heat. And why is [Mathys] Tel still playing? I’d rather Richarlison played. He’s guff, he’s terrible, he’s got trampoline feet. He’s everything that’s bad about Tottenham.
